This makes sense, the timing sounds right for when sewing machines started going to the wider 7mm zig zag from the 5mm common to the earlier machines. 9mm seems to be common nowadays, and I *think* I've read that new machines are going to 11mm. Holy cow, you'd have to use some heavy stabilizer under a zig zag that wide, and think of how much thread it would use.

My new Pfaff Quilt Expression 4.2 has a 9mm zig zag. Since its that wide, I can't use the 1/4" foot for piecing quilt blocks, the foot only rides on the left feed dog and it won't sew nicely. I use the regular foot and just move the needle over to where I get a 1/4".
